Sermorelin
Sermorelin is a growth hormone releasing hormone (GHRH) analog. Unlike synthetic HGH (which is a controlled substance), sermorelin stimulates your pituitary to produce more growth hormone naturally. Benefits include improved sleep quality, body composition, recovery speed, and skin quality.

NAD+ (n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ide) declines approximately 50% between ages 40 and 60. It's essential for cellular energy production, DNA repair, and sirtuin activation. Supplementation via IV infusion, sublingual drops, or oral precursors (NMN, NR) aims to restore declining levels.
IV NAD+ costs $250–1,000 per session. Oral NMN supplements run $40–60/month. The evidence for anti-aging benefits is promising but still primarily from animal models; human trials are ongoing.

BPC-157
BPC-157 (Body Protection Compound-157) is a synthetic peptide derived from a protein found in gastric juice. Animal studies show remarkable tissue repair properties — tendon healing, gut repair, neuroprotection. The biohacking community swears by it for injury recovery.
The problem: there are zero published human clinical trials. All evidence comes from rodent studies. BPC-157 is not FDA-approved, not available as a prescription medication, and is sold through "research chemical" vendors with no quality controls. Purity, sterility, and dosing accuracy are unknowns.
CJC-1295 + Ipamorelin
This combination stimulates growth hormone release through two complementary mechanisms. Some anti-aging clinics offer it as a prescription, though the regulatory status varies by state. More robust evidence exists for each component individually than for the combination.

Is HGH the same as sermorelin?
No. HGH (human growth hormone) is a controlled substance — the actual hormone injected directly. Sermorelin stimulates your pituitary to produce more of your own HGH naturally. Sermorelin is legal via prescription; HGH requires specific diagnoses.
Are research peptides safe?
Unknown. Without pharmaceutical manufacturing standards, purity and sterility aren't guaranteed. This is the core risk — not the peptide itself but the unknown quality of the product you receive.
Will my doctor prescribe BPC-157?
Most conventional physicians won't prescribe it due to the lack of human clinical data. Some integrative medicine doctors will. It depends on the practitioner and state regulations.
How do I know if a peptide vendor is legitimate?
For prescription peptides (sermorelin, NAD+): use licensed telehealth providers that partner with state-licensed pharmacies. For OTC supplements (NMN, NR): choose brands with third-party testing certificates (NSF, USP).
